摘 要:通过实际教学情况,设计实施了共聚反应单体竞聚率测定的设计性教学实验,并以核磁共振的方法进行结果测定.通过实验教学,学生掌握了温度变化对竞聚率影响的实验方法,提高了理论联系实际的能力,使抽象理论实际化,让学生初步建立起抽象与具体的联系,并且充分拓展了学生的视野和思维.在增加了实验趣味性的同时也优化了教学方式和课程体系,取得了良好的教学效果.The experiment is used NMR to determinate the reactivity ratio of the copolymerization reaction between styrene and methacrylate.Through the experiment teaching students mastered the method of the influence on the reactivity ratio with temperature changing.Students’ability of connecting theory with practice is improved and abstract theory is actualized.Moreover it would be expanding students’vision and thinking.It also increased the interesting of the experiment and optimized the teaching method and curriculum system.In the end it produced good teaching results as well.
